Impurity standard preparation
Dissolve accurately weighed quantities of
USP Methyldopa RSand USP Carbidopa Related Compound A RSin
Mobile phaseto obtain a solution having a known concentration of about 2.5µg of each per mL.
Procedure
Separately inject equal volumes (about 20µL)of the
Impurity standard preparationand the
Assay preparationinto the chromatograph by means of a suitable sampling valve,and measure the peak responses.The relative retention times of methyldopa,carbidopa,and carbidopa related compound Aare about 0.8,1.0,and 1.8,respectively.Calculate the percentage of methyldopa in the portion of Carbidopa taken by the formula:
10(C/W)(rU/rS),
in which
Cis the concentration,in µg per mL,of
USP Methyldopa RSin the
Impurity standard preparation;Wis the weight,in mg,of Carbidopa taken for the
Assay preparation;and
rUand
rSare the peak responses for methyldopa obtained from the
Assay and the
Impurity standard preparation,respectively.The limit is 0.5%.Calculate the percentage of carbidopa related compound Ain the portion of Carbidopa taken by the formula:
10(C/W)(rU/rS),
in which
Cis the concentration,in µg per mL,of USP Carbidopa Related Compound A RSin the
Impurity standard preparation;Wis the weight,in mg,of carbidopa taken for the
Assay preparation;and
rUand
rSare the peak responses for carbidopa related compound Aobtained from the
Assay preparationand the
Impurity standard preparation,respectively.The limit is 0.5%.
